**Checklist item 7 — Broker key ceremony (Thornrelay 4.x upgrade)**

Before upgrading the Thornrelay brokers, two custodians must be present in the ceremony room with the sealed envelope from the prior quarter. Verify the envelope's tamper seal, confirm the broker cluster is in maintenance mode, and that replication lag reads zero on all three nodes. Only then may the signing key be re-wrapped. Record the ceremony in the ledger, then read aloud and verify the recovery passphrase, which is:

strongbox words: wenix-ulador

# ProctorPipe queue config — notes for Thursday's eng sync
# Quick context for whoever touches this next: the exam-proctoring
# queue on the Welbern cluster was dropping sessions whenever
# SESSION_TTL_SECONDS dipped below 900, so it's pinned at 1200 now.
# QUEUE_CONCURRENCY is 8 per node; going higher starved the video
# snapshot workers. If you see backlog alarms, check the Hollis
# dashboard before changing anything here. The queue broker now
# requires auth after last week's hardening pass, so the credential
# sits on the very next line.

env line for fafof-fahag: LEDGER_TOKEN5=f8790

**Runbook: Clock skew between build agents**

If artifacts show timestamps from the future or signing fails mysteriously, suspect skew on the Bramblehurst agent pool. Check drift with the pool status dashboard — anything over two seconds is trouble. Restart the time-sync daemon on the offending agent, then re-run the build. Confirm the fix by re-running the job that produced the token below.

session token of tajef-bageg = htk21_5d90d574934f3ccae6437

# Basement Archive Room — Night Access

The archive room under Pellworth House holds old contracts and the tape backups. Night shift: take stairwell C, not the lift (it's switched off after midnight). Lights are on a timer by the door — slap the button as you go in. Sign the logbook, even at 3am, yes really. The keypad by the door takes the code below.

staff pass of fahap-tajeg = bdg-FT-6